You´re welcome! Glad I could help. I just changed my rear tire due to the same reason. I took the wheel off the bike and took it to a shop for them to do the change over. Reason was they also balance the tire just like you would have a car/truck tire done. Beleive it or not they had to remove a few of the factory weights from the orginal mount. You also may want to consider replacing the tube as well.......that´s if yours has a tube. (If your wheel has spokes, you have a tube) Cost of tube is $4.95 and to have the a new tire put on and balanced was 18.00. This included a new valve stem too. My bike has sat for many years and due to rising gas prices I decided to restore it at the lowest cost possible. I feel much safer knowing that my tube is new and not dry rotted even though it was holding air. Michelle |
